About this horse

Suited best as a trail and all-around riding prospect, this 12-year-old registered Chincoteague Pony gelding is described as going walk, trot, and canter under saddle and recently completed 60 days of refresher training after a year off. The listing presents him as willing and responsive rather than beginner-safe at this stage, with additional benefit expected from continued desensitizing and softening work. He is reported to load and haul well, stand for grooming, saddling, and the farrier, cross-tie, and handle quietly on the ground, with no bucking, bolting, or rearing disclosed. He stands 14 hands and is suggested for uses such as Western Dressage, Working Equitation, or trail riding.
